I'm looking to buy this house to stay and don't believe that certain numbers can bring bad luck. However, I'm concern that I might not be able to sell the house when I need to, which might be about 10 to 20 years down the line.

So should I be concern about this number 4 house? Would you buy?

In Malaysia, only 20% of the population will not like that number.
Most important is that you are okay with it since you will be staying there anyway.

You can ask the seller for maybe further discount, so when you want to sell you can give the same discount to your future buyer ...
